The Web3 Nonprofit Podcast series

The Web3 Nonprofit is a special 10-part Crypto Altruism podcast series highlighting nonprofit organization all over the world who are leveraging Web3, AI, and other next gen technologies to build a better world. In each episode we highlight a different nonprofit organization with a unique mission and impact, and share tips and tricks for nonprofits looking to leverage tech for good.

Thank you to Endaoment for their support in bringing this series to life!

Nonprofits are leveraging Web3 technologies to improve transparency, reduce costs, and expand their reach. Through blockchain, smart contracts, and decentralized finance (DeFi), they can enhance fundraising, ensure accountability, and create new incentives for social impact, all while building more inclusive and efficient systems for global change.

The Web3 Nonprofit Episode 9 - Outright International
Philanthropy & Activism
February 8, 2024
For the ninth episode of The Web3 Nonprofit, we welcome Katie Hultquist, Director of Leadership Giving for Outright International, an incredible nonprofit that is advancing human rights for LGBTIQ people everywhere through advocacy, support, and research. They have also done an excellent job engaging with the Web3 community and partnering with some fantastic projects in the space.

The Web3 Nonprofit Episode 8 - Edinburgh Dog and Cat Home
Philanthropy & Activism
January 25, 2024
For the eighth episode of The Web3 Nonprofit, we welcome David Mitchell, Cryptocurrency and Digital Partnership Manager for Edinburgh Dog and Cat Home, a nonprofit that “protects loving homes, finds loving homes, and runs a loving home for dogs and cats in East and Central Scotland.” They are also a true pioneer in the world of crypto philanthropy, forming diverse partnerships in the space.

The Web3 Nonprofit Episode 6 - The Solar Foundation
Regenerative Finance
November 16, 2023
For the sixth episode of The Web3 Nonprofit, we’re excited to welcome Coleen Chase and Jon Ruth of The Solar Foundation, a nonprofit with a mission to fund and accelerate off-grid solar for underserved communities in emerging markets. They believe that decentralized clean energy is a public good and are exploring how blockchain can help make this a reality.

The Web3 Nonprofit Episode 7 - The Life You Can Save
Philanthropy & Activism
November 30, 2023
For the seventh episode of The Web3 Nonprofit, we’re excited to welcome Jon Behar of The Life You Can Save, a nonprofit on a mission to “make “smart giving simple” by curating a group of nonprofits that save or improve the most lives per dollar.” We dive into how they’re leveraging Web3 to advance this mission, and their upcoming Quadratic Funding round on Gitcoin’s Grant Stack!

The Web3 Nonprofit Episode 10 - Sostento
Philanthropy & Activism
April 4, 2024
For the tenth and final episode of The Web3 Nonprofit, we welcome Joe Agoada, Founder and CEO of Sostento, a charitable organizations with a mission to support those that serve on the frontlines of public health in order to save lives, and to increase equitable access to lifesaving healthcare services. They are also an early adopter in the Web3 philanthropy space.
